aXbo Alarm Clock Review
May 3rd, 2006
Remember that aXbo Alarm Clock that knows when it’s best to wake you by monitoring your sleep cycles? Well, the guys at Digital Reviews got their hands on one. They determined that for the most part setup and use will be intuitive with no need to read the manual, but for optimum operation they suggest a quick read for sensor placement, etc. They also noted that the device could use a few improvements, such a vibrating mode just incase your partner doesn’t want to be disturbed. Taking advantage of the already placed sensors to determine your sleep cycles, the alarm knows when you’re asleep such that it can turn off the optional sound soothing wave crashes or chirping crickets – saves on battery life too. Digital Reviews concluded their review by giving the aXbo an 8/10, and said “if you want to feel what it is like to wake up refreshed every morning this will be one of your better investments.�

Hello. We have an aXbo clock. It’s not cheap, but I’m a gadget collector who also tend to choose the usefull ones. Actually, it works fine. It failed two times only (in two weeks now, and two person using, so 4 weeks for one person) - in thoose cases not the normal clear and nice sound is played, but an awful high frequency tone to make sure you wake up. The other cases are just great - with the lowest volume I’m up and ready in seconds :)
Also, It’s recommended to use the software, check your graph and set the alarm time according to that - having it in the middle of the deep sleep phase does not help.
